When the “Enable Partial File Name Match” option is turned ON, users can upload a CSV file that contains file names that may not exactly match the uploaded file names.


The system will automatically try to identify and map the correct uploaded file based on a partial file name match. This helps reduce manual effort when file names in the CSV are slightly different from the actual uploaded file names.


Example:

1. Go to the Mass File Upload tab.

2. Click on the CSV tab. When the warning window appears, click OK.

3. Now select files. or Attachment from the 'Select File/Attachment' drop-down

4. Now, upload the files while clicking on the 'Upload Files' button.

5. Turn ON the toggle “Enable Partial File Name Match”

6. Upload the CSV file, which contains the file names related to the files uploaded in Step 4.

7. Now you will see the table is rendered, and the files are mapped with the correct records. As you can see, the file name in the CSV and the uploaded file did not exactly match their names, but the file was still uploaded to the respective records successfully.
